May 24, 2023 · Cellulitis symptoms. Symptoms of cellulitis include: Redness in the skin on different parts of the body, usually the lower leg. The redness gets worse over a day or two, becoming painful. The cellulitis skin will look a bit shiny. The skin is smooth; it is not bumpy or raised. A carbuncle is a cluster of boils that form a connected area of infection under the skin. Boils (furuncles) usually start as reddish or purplish, tender bumps. The bumps quickly fill with pus, growing larger and more painful until they rupture and drain. Apply cool compress on the area for at least 5 minutes each day. Observe if the discolorations have improved. Conenose (or kissing) bugs. These are relatively large insects, 10-30 mm- (3/4 to 1 1/8 inch-) long. They emerge at night to feed on vertebrate blood, but are uncommon in well-constructed homes. Bites occur most commonly on hands, arms, feet, head or other areas exposed during sleep. The condition causes a bump or red welts on the skin in reaction to an insect bite or sting. In people with papular urticaria, these bites cause long-lasting, red, raised, itchy bumps to develop on the skin. It can also cause small blisters (called vesicles) to form on the skin, sometimes in clusters.
